  • Patent number: 10523775
    Abstract: Methods and apparatus, including computer program products, are provided for flow control. In one aspect, there is provided a method, wherein the method may include monitoring, by an external flow controller, a workflow at a first cloud application to determine whether at least one condition is satisfied to extend the workflow to a second cloud application external to the first cloud application; diverting, by the external flow controller, when the at least one condition is satisfied; handling, by the external flow controller, a request to divert the workflow to the second cloud application by at least formatting the request in accordance with configuration information at the external flow controller; sending, by the external flow controller, the workflow to the second cloud application; receiving, by the external flow controller, a result to incorporate into the workflow at the first cloud application; and/or proceeding with the workflow at the first cloud application.

  • Publication number: 20140058919
    Abstract: An exemplary aspect comprises receiving data related to an underlying asset; calculating values corresponding to near-term implied volatility and realized volatility for the underlying asset; and transmitting data sufficient to describe an index based on a difference between the values corresponding to the near-term implied volatility and the realized volatility for the underlying asset. Another exemplary aspect comprises receiving electronic data related to an underlying asset; calculating data sufficient to describe a plurality of call options and a plurality of put options related to the underlying asset and written on a first settlement date; crediting an account with proceeds from selling the call and put options; and debiting the account to settle one or more of the options that are in-the-money on a second settlement date. Other aspects are apparent from the description and claims.

  • Patent number: 6934044
    Abstract: An apparatus is disclosed for improved network printing including a plurality of client machines connected by a network, a printer connected to the network by a network interface controller, a printer server connected to the printer, a printer controller connected to the printer, and a header analyzer embedded into a memory of the printer controller. A method is also disclosed of improved networked printing using a header analyzer in a networked component to monitor and repair incoming print jobs, and outputting the repaired print jobs to a printer. Also disclosed is an apparatus for improved networked printing that includes a plurality of client machines connected by a network, a printer connected to the network by a network interface controller, a printer server connected to the printer, a printer controller connected to the printer, and a filter embedded into a memory of each of the plurality of workstations.
